Transaction 20cbf2dbbb9bbc0515f98bd165fed86967ea7bbb746829d2b75bb333d24c231e

14 Input
2 Outputs
  • 20cbf2dbbb9bbc0515f98bd165fed86967ea7bbb746829d2b75bb333d24c231e:0
  • value  27070
    address  3MVkJ3DDqzknFZd6St4yepZm6NUjWmRBrT
  • 20cbf2dbbb9bbc0515f98bd165fed86967ea7bbb746829d2b75bb333d24c231e:1
  • value  2660657
    address  1BDwsdpcHDPpyhgr1Svcen3KCJGccapg4o